Besides the euphoria of rebranding, Lafarge Africa’s name change and new corporate identity means so much for the company as well as the Nigeria economy, authorities of the company have said.
The company, at an elaborate ceremony in Lagos recently, announced that it has changed its name from Lafarge Africa Plc to HBM Nigeria Plc, without any adverse effect on its operations or the workforce.
This name change will not affect the company’s operations, workforce, customers, shareholders, or its unwavering commitment to Nigeria’s economic growth and infrastructure development, Lolu Alade-Akinyemi, the Group Managing Director/Chief Executive Officer, assured.
He explained that the change to HBM Nigeria Plc reflects the company’s continued evolution as one of Nigeria’s leading building solutions providers, combining strong local roots with enhanced global industrial collaboration.
He said the new identity signals a forward-looking phase for the company, driven by operational excellence, innovation, sustainability, and long-term value creation.
